Based on the pattern, what are the next two terms of the sequence?
2, 5, 8, 11, . . .?
2 answers:
Answer:
14, 17
Step-by-step explanation:
Note the differences in consecutive terms of the sequence
5 - 2 = 3
8 - 5 = 3
11 - 8 = 3
The differences are constant
To find the next term in the sequence add 3 to the previous term, that is
11 + 3 = 14
14 + 3 = 17
